First BlackBerry smartphone to support TD-SCDMA technology
Waterloo, ON and Beijing, China – Research In Motion (RIM) (NASDAQ: RIMM; TSX: RIM) and China Mobile today introduced the BlackBerry® Bold™ 9788 smartphone, the newest addition to China Mobile’s BlackBerry® smartphone offering and the first to support the nation’s TD-SCDMA wireless network.
Featuring a sleek, iconic design and an incredibly easy-to-use keyboard, the BlackBerry Bold 9788 is elegantly styled and packed with powerful communications, multimedia and productivity features.

Just a quick reminder for more OS 7 device launches. Telus now officially carries the BlackBerry Bold 9900 and Torch 9810. Here’s a quick rundown on the pricing in case you missed it before. The Bold 9900 runs $149 on a 3 year, $529 on a 2 year, $579 on a 1 year, and $629 with no contract. The Torch 9810 gets $129 on a 3 year, $499 on a 2 year, $549 on a 1 year, and 599 with no contract. Also, the Torch 9810 comes in both grey and white color while the Bold remains in black only at the moment. Click the links below to check out more info on the devices.

India has picked up the Bold 9900 officially today for the price of Rs. 32,490 which is about $700 USD. The launch was expected to be later on, so it definitely caught citizens off guard who were waiting around for the device. There’s no word on other OS 7 devices including the Torch 9810 and Torch 9850/9860 but the Bold definitely suffices.
